Suzanne Wolf

Program Services Manager at Alaska Native Tribal Health Consortium

Suzanne Wolf has a diverse work experience spanning over a decade. Suzanne started their career in 2009 as a Summer Intern at First Alaskans Institute. In 2009, they also worked as a Business Office Specialist at Alaska Native Tribal Health Consortium (ANTHC). Suzanne then progressed to roles such as Rural Energy Initiative Program Administrator, Program Services Administrator, and Special Assistant to the Chairman & President. From 2017 to 2023, Suzanne served as a Business Support Manager at ANTHC. Currently, they hold the position of Program Services Manager at ANTHC, where they manage the overall performance of the Program Services Department and plays a crucial role in decision-making processes. Suzanne is a valuable member of the Division Leadership Team, contributing to the strategy and implementation of division direction and program guidance.

Suzanne Wolf obtained a Bachelor's Degree in Business Administration from the University of Alaska Anchorage in 2016.
